Reinhart scored a goal and blocked two shots in Saturday's 4-3 shootout win over the Stars.
Reinhart's tally Saturday was the 300th of his career, coming in his 787th game. It took some time for the 29-year-old to find his groove, but in five years in Florida, he's potted no less than 31 goals in each of his first four seasons as a Panther. He's off to a positive start in 2025-26 as well, scoring six goals, including one in each of the last four contests. He's added an assist, 36 shots on net, 14 hits, 10 blocked shots and a minus-3 rating over 12 appearances.
